/*
 * Isometric rendering engine.
 */
#pragma once

#include <stdbool.h>
#include <stdint.h>

typedef struct IsoGfx IsoGfx;

/// Sprite sheet handle.
typedef uint16_t SpriteSheet;

/// Sprite handle.
typedef uint16_t Sprite;

/// Tile handle.
typedef uint16_t Tile;

/// Colour channel.
typedef uint8_t Channel;

typedef struct Pixel {
  Channel r, g, b, a;
} Pixel;

typedef enum TileDescType {
  TileFromColour,
  TileFromFile,
  TileFromMemory,
} TileDescType;

typedef struct TileDesc {
  TileDescType type;
  int          width;  /// Tile width in pixels.
  int          height; /// Tile height in pixels.
  union {
    Pixel colour; /// Constant colour tile.
    struct {
      const char* path;
    } file;
    struct {
      const uint8_t* data; /// sizeof(Pixel) * width * height
    } mem;
  };
} TileDesc;

typedef struct WorldDesc {
  int tile_width;    /// Base tile width in pixels.
  int tile_height;   /// Base tile height in pixels.
  int world_width;   /// World width in tiles.
  int world_height;  /// World height in tiles.
  int max_num_tiles; /// 0 for an implementation-defined default.
} WorldDesc;

typedef struct IsoGfxDesc {
  int screen_width;                 /// Screen width in pixels.
  int screen_height;                /// Screen height in pixels.
  int max_num_sprites;              /// 0 for an implementation-defined default.
  int sprite_sheet_pool_size_bytes; /// 0 for an implementation-defined default.
} IsoGfxDesc;

/// Create a new isometric graphics engine.
IsoGfx* isogfx_new(const IsoGfxDesc*);

/// Destroy the isometric graphics engine.
void isogfx_del(IsoGfx**);

/// Create an empty world.
bool isogfx_make_world(IsoGfx*, const WorldDesc*);

/// Load a world from a tile map (.TM) file.
bool isogfx_load_world(IsoGfx*, const char* filepath);

/// Return the world's width.
int isogfx_world_width(const IsoGfx*);

/// Return the world's height.
int isogfx_world_height(const IsoGfx*);

/// Create a new tile.
Tile isogfx_make_tile(IsoGfx*, const TileDesc*);

/// Set the tile at position (x,y).
void isogfx_set_tile(IsoGfx*, int x, int y, Tile);

/// Set the tiles in positions in the range (x0,y0) - (x1,y1).
void isogfx_set_tiles(IsoGfx*, int x0, int y0, int x1, int y1, Tile);

/// Load a sprite sheet (.SS) file.
bool isogfx_load_sprite_sheet(IsoGfx*, const char* filepath, SpriteSheet*);

/// Create an animated sprite.
Sprite isogfx_make_sprite(IsoGfx*, SpriteSheet);

/// Destroy the sprite.
void isogfx_del_sprite(IsoGfx*, Sprite);

/// Destroy all the sprites.
void isogfx_del_sprites(IsoGfx*);

/// Set the sprite's position.
void isogfx_set_sprite_position(IsoGfx*, Sprite, int x, int y);

/// Set the sprite's current animation.
void isogfx_set_sprite_animation(IsoGfx*, Sprite, int animation);

/// Update the renderer.
///
/// Currently this updates the sprite animations.
void isogfx_update(IsoGfx*, double t);

/// Render the world.
void isogfx_render(IsoGfx*);

/// Draw/overlay a tile at position (x,y).
///
/// This function just renders a tile at position (x,y) and should be called
/// after isogfx_render() to obtain the correct result. To set the tile at
/// position (x,y) instead, use isogfx_set_tile().
void isogfx_draw_tile(IsoGfx*, int x, int y, Tile);

/// Resize the virtual screen's dimensions.
bool isogfx_resize(IsoGfx*, int screen_width, int screen_height);

/// Get the virtual screen's dimensions.
void isogfx_get_screen_size(const IsoGfx*, int* width, int* height);

/// Return a pointer to the virtual screen's colour buffer.
///
/// Call after each call to isogfx_render() to retrieve the render output.
const Pixel* isogfx_get_screen_buffer(const IsoGfx*);

/// Translate Cartesian to isometric coordinates.
void isogfx_pick_tile(
    const IsoGfx*, double xcart, double ycart, int* xiso, int* yiso);
